About Jie Han

Jie Han is a scholar working on Marketing, Economics and Econometrics and Strategy and Management, having authored 29 papers that have together received 329 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Energy, Environment, Economic Growth (10 papers), Energy, Environment, and Transportation Policies (5 papers), Climate Change Policy and Economics (5 papers), Corporate Social Responsibility Reporting (3 papers), Energy and Environment Impacts (3 papers),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(3 papers), Consumer Behavior in Brand Consumption and Identification (2 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Marketing (105 citations), Economics and Econometrics (151 citations) and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(47 citations). Jie Han has collaborated with scholars based in China, Türkiye and United States. Frequent co-authors include Chanthika Pornpitakpan, Cem Işık, Muhammad Anas, Srinath Perera, Junying Liu, Yingbin Feng, Wei Zhang, Michael T. Hannan, Glenn R. Carroll and Stanislav D. Dobrev. Their work appears in journals such as Environmental Science and Pollution Research, Journal of Environmental Management, International Review of Economics & Finance, Sustainability and Australasian Marketing Journal (AMJ).
